Drug and alcohol treatment services are available in other non-English languages from rehab programs with bilingual staff as well as from addiction recovery educational groups and services offered in other languages. Drug rehab centers in Idlewild that deliver treatment services in other languages will give group counseling or therapy in those languages, and will provide either hard copy or digital educational materials available in those languages as well. The most common "other-language" programs available are Spanish language rehab services, because Spanish speaking clients constitute the highest percentage of other language speaking people needing treatment. Attending such a program when English is not your first language can be helpful for more reasons than the difficulties with verbal communication, because there are also cultural differences and other things to be taken into consideration. When treating someone who speaks another language the treatment staff must not only be able to communicate with them clearly and expressively, but also identify with their culture, background, and specific challenges and values that should be considered when attempting to treat their addiction problem. Someone searching for treatment in other languages will want to ensure the facility has staff that are able to deliver services in their native language but who are also able to identify and understand their culture and social customs.
